ClimateTech startup Crosstown has raised €2.5 million in funding to support the commercial rollout of its H2R® Burner technology – a retrofit solution that allows existing gas turbines (such as those from Rolls‑Royce, GE, Siemens, ABB) to operate on 100% renewable fuels like hydrogen. The technology is designed to significantly cut NOₓ emissions and reduce up to 300,000 tons of CO₂ annually per 100 MW turbine.
The investment – backed by leading investors and public institutions – will help Crosstown expand internationally, accelerate the deployment of its patented solution across Europe, and contribute meaningfully to the continent’s energy transformation by repurposing existing power infrastructure.
